History of Bombora Custom Furniture
Luke began designing and building custom timber furniture in Melbourne 12 years ago to create a beautiful home on a student's budget. Out of necessity grew a passion for wood, design and working with his hands.
In Feb 2011, after the house was full of beautiful pieces, Luke made two wooden dining tables which he quickly sold on Gumtree. From there, Luke began to receive orders and the word-of-mouth referrals kept coming.
After the birth of their Daughter early in 2012, the Collins family decided to have a sea change and move from Melbourne to Torquay on the Victorian Surf Coast. Alison came on board to develop the business with the hope that Luke would be able to quit his “day job” as a firefighter. In 2014, with two staff members, Luke was finally able to give in his notice and be a full-time furniture maker.
In 2021 Bombora took the plunge to move from our idyllic setting looking over the hills at Ashmore Arts to purchase our factory in Torquay. After a crazy couple of months of fitting out the new factory, we moved into our new home!

Bombora Showroom and Workshop
Located in Torquay 30 minutes from Geelong and 1 hour from Melbourne, our workshop is where all the magic happens. All the timber elements of our custom timber furniture are created by our furniture makers in the workshop. The stone tops of our timber vanities and metal legs for our wooden dining table designs are created by other local manufacturers.
The Bombora showroom displays some of our timber vanity designs as well as doors, bench tops, concrete basins and shaving cabinets.
